What Equipment is Needed for Real Estate Photography?

Real estate photography is a great way to showcase properties in their best light and create stunning images.

To achieve this, it is important to use the right equipment, lighting and composition.

The most basic equipment needed for real estate photography is a digital single-lens reflex (DSLR) camera with a wide-angle lens.

A wide-angle lens will allow you to capture the entire room, including all the details of the property.

For interior shots, you will also need to use natural light from windows to illuminate the room.

For exterior shots, a tripod is essential to keep the camera steady while taking pictures.

The tripod will also help to reduce camera shake, which can cause blurry images.

Additionally, it is important to use different angles and perspectives to capture the details of the property.

Finally, you will need to edit the photos using photo editing software such as Adobe Lightroom to enhance the images and make them even better.

How to Use Natural Lighting for Interior Shots

Real estate photography is all about capturing the best possible images of a property, and one of the best ways to do that is to use natural lighting.

When photographing the interior of a property, natural light from windows or doors can be used to illuminate the room and add a sense of warmth and life to the photos.

To make the most of natural light, use a wide-angle lens to capture the entire room and adjust the shutter speed to allow more light in.

You can also use reflectors to bounce light off of walls and other surfaces, and to fill in any dark corners or shadows.

If you dont have access to natural light, you can also use artificial lighting such as LED lights, LED panels, and flashlights.

By using a combination of natural and artificial lighting, you can create stunning real estate photos.

How to Use a Tripod for Exterior Shots

Using a tripod for exterior shots is an essential part of real estate photography.

A tripod will help you keep your camera steady and allow for longer exposures, which can help create beautiful images.

The key when using a tripod is to make sure its sturdy and secure before you take your shot.

You should also look for a tripod with a panoramic head, which allows you to tilt, pan and rotate the camera for different angles.

Additionally, if youre shooting in low light, a tripod will help you keep your camera steady while taking longer exposures which will help you get better results.

Finally, make sure to adjust the height of your tripod to match the height of the propertys exterior.

This will help you capture the full view of the property and create balanced images.

Different Angles and Perspectives to Capture the Details of the Property

When taking real estate photos, it is important to make use of different angles and perspectives in order to capture the details of the property.

Taking pictures from different angles can help bring out small details that may have been missed when taking the photo from a single point of view.

For example, a photo looking straight down a hallway may not capture the intricacy of a doorframe or the pattern of a tile floor, but a photo taken from an angle may do so.

Additionally, photos taken from different angles can help to emphasize the size of a room or the unique elements of a property.

When taking photos from different angles, it is important to consider the composition of the photo.

Make sure that the camera is positioned in such a way that the elements of the photo are balanced and the focal point is clear.

Additionally, it is important to consider the lines created by walls, windows, furniture, and other elements to create a more interesting photo.

Finally, for interior shots, it is important to consider the use of natural light.

Natural light can add a beautiful glow to a photo and help to show off the details of the property.

When taking pictures in a room with limited natural light, consider the use of additional lighting such as lamps and table lights.

This can help to create a more interesting and engaging photo.

Tips for Editing Real Estate Photos

When it comes to editing real estate photos, there are some tips and tricks that can help you create stunning results.

First, use software such as Adobe Lightroom to adjust the exposure, contrast, saturation, and sharpness of the images.

You can also use the crop tool to frame the image exactly how you want it, or use the spot healing brush to remove any distracting elements.

Additionally, you can use tools such as the graduated filter to add a more dramatic effect to the image.

Finally, you may want to experiment with various filters to give your photos an extra creative touch.

Benefits of Using Adobe Lightroom for Editing

Adobe Lightroom is an invaluable tool for any real estate photographer looking to edit and enhance their images.

With its powerful editing capabilities, Lightroom gives you the ability to quickly adjust exposure, contrast, saturation, highlights, shadows, and more.

You can also apply filters, add effects, and retouch blemishes and small details.

With all of these features, you can easily turn your photos into stunning works of art.

Not only does it make your photos look great, but it also saves you time and energy by giving you the ability to batch edit multiple photos at once.

Professional real estate photographers rely on Lightroom to help them edit their photos quickly and easily.
